Carbon Fiber Reinforced Silicon Carbide

Carbon fiber reinforced silicon carbide (CFRSC) is an advanced ceramic material with excellent toughness, oxidation and corrosion resistance properties that is often utilized in aerospace applications like control planes, leading edges of wings and nose cones. Nitride Bonded Silicon Carbide

Nitride-bonded silicon carbide is an incredibly strong and tough material with exceptional corrosion resistance properties that makes an ideal side wall material for large prebaked aluminum electrolytic cells. Silicon Carbide and Its Applications

Silicon carbide (also referred to as carborundum) is one of the world’s most useful chemical compounds, with only small quantities occurring naturally as moissanite in meteorites or corundum deposits; most is created synthetically. Carbon Bonded Silicon Carbide Crucible

Carbon bonded silicon carbide crucible is a high-temperature container designed for melting precious and base metals in induction furnace. It boasts fast heat conduction as well as resistance against acid and alkaline corrosion; in addition, its construction ensures thermal shock resistance.
